Thank you all whom celebrated Utah Saves Week. Here is a recap of the week!

In Juab County a piggy bank contest and movie night was planned. The movie Richie Rich was a great reminder to save. Along with the movie, there was goal sharing over dinner along and a computer lab to present great financial websites.  

Duchesne 4-H Teen Council hosted a piggy bank decorating event also. By using basic ceramic pots, the youth were able to create any type of coin holder they could imagine. Some made chickens banks, clown banks, bunny banks, and art deco banks. Just goes to show, you can save money anywhere you choose to!
 
If you were driving in Salt Lake this week you might have seen signs hanging up promoting different businesses celebrating Utah Saves Week. These businesses held classes during the week in order to promote a healthy financial lifestyle.
 
Al Bingham spoke in different areas of the state about creating a better credit score. At one of his workshops in Provo, many community members gathered to hear about the importance of a great credit report and how to improve there own credit score.
 
Cedar City schools partnered with the State Bank of Southern Utah to hold a Utah Saves Art Contest. To the left is one of the overall winners. The caption on the page says, "A penny saved means my money works for me!"

What is Utah Saves Week?

Utah Saves Week is an initiative aimed at bringing together hundreds of Utah institutions and organizations in a concerted effort to increase awareness. Our goal is to promote greater household savings and reduced debt so that all Utahns are building wealth. Based in part on Money Saves Weeks organized by the Chicago Federal Reserve Bank, it is celebrated by all Saves campaigns around the country and, perhaps eventually, inspire a National savings month endorsed by the United States Congress.  The primary focus of Utah Saves Week is to encourage Financial Action – commitments to save, invest and build wealth.
